Glad you like it and it sounds like you might get some use out of it too !

For a unit of 24 i'd say between 2 and 4 flags, there's 28 in the pike square above and they have 4 flags.
There are a few flags illustrated on the flags and banners page of the painting guide. 3 of the 4 in the image above feature on there. I make my own so i'm not really sure who are the better stockists though in saying that I know that Progloria miniatures have a small range as well as pete at italianwarsflags.blogspot.com any that he doesnt have he'd be glad to make up for you i would imagine.
